Following some 2 years of negotiations, 4 mobile network operators (MNOs) have executed share subscription agreements (SSAs) for a total of 65 per cent equity stake in Digital Nasional Berhad (DNB). The four MNOs are YTL Communications Sdn Bhd (YES), Telekom Malaysia (TM), Digi Telecommunications Sdn Bhd (Digi) and Celcom Axiata Bhd (Celcom).

It looks like the Digi and Celcom merger is getting close to completion after the Securities Commission Malaysia’s (SC) approval of the proposed merger between the two local telco giants. This announcement comes after almost 2 months after the Malaysian Communications and Multimedia Commission (MCMC) also gave its approval for the merger.

Finance Minister: DNB stakes may be offered to foreign telco companies after Maxis and U Mobile snub
Sep 02, 2022
Finance Minister Tengku Datuk Seri Zafrul Tengku Aziz has assured Malaysians that the decision by two Mobile Network Operators (MNO) to reject holding stakes in Digital Nasional Berhad (DNB) doesn’t have a huge financial impact on the government. This is because there are several local and foreign banks that are ready to finance the 5G network implementation in Malaysia.
